Cuba’s foreign intelligence service (the DGI) not only hoped to gather information but also sought to foment conflict and sow distrust within the émigré population.[1] Cuba had previously demonstrated its desire to neutralize the influence of US-based Cubans, when, in the late 1970s, the DGI developed “Plan Alpha”, which envisioned splitting the Cuban-American community, as part of a push for normalized relations between Washington and Havana.[2] … [read post]

A radiation dose of 2.5 KGy reduced C. jejuni levels on retail poultry by 10 log10 units. [1] Further, with poultry, contamination levels peak during the summer months [1, 5, 28], and this seasonal pattern is reflected in the number of reported Campylobacter infections. [5, 28] Transmission of and Infection with Campylobacter Most Campylobacter infections in humans are caused by the consumption of contaminated food or water.
